<p>Spring recruiting is in full swing, with several prospects in Indiana seeing their recruiting blow up, or some landing their first offers. Here are four Hoosier State prospects who have been on a roll over the past two weeks, with two new verbal commitments and two new prospects receiving offers.</p>

<p class="text-gray-700">The offers are rolling in for North Central Class of 2028 quarterback Chase Grove. After competing at the Prep Redzone Exposure Series in Carmel, he has since earned offers from Toledo and Kansas, and more are to be expected. His quick release and strong arm are hard for college coaches to ignore. He could easily become a 40-offer prospect especially with a strong junior year; finished with 1,901 yards and 19 touchdowns last season with four rushing touchdowns to boot.</p>

<p class="text-gray-700">One thing strikes us about Plainfield wide receiver Zander Nattam: speed. He knows one gear, and that's fast. Nattam has tremendous straight-line juice after the catch, a home-run threat with the ball in his hands Nattmam is a crafty route runner who can get open creatively, make catches over the middle of the field and make plays. Totaling 994 combined yards rushing and receiving and 27 touchdowns, the Class of 2027 prospect is a key returning playmaker for the Quakers. Earned offers from Thomas More, Gannon and Indiana Wesleyan.</p>

<p class="text-gray-700">We were the first to note Nate Stokes' talents after a visit to school. The 6-foot-0, 180-pound Warren Central Class of 2028 tailback is a great contributor on both sides of the ball. He is a strong tailback with good contact balance and the ability to turn the corner, get out in space and break away from defenses if he finds a crease. Stokes picked up his first offer from Bowling Green; expect more to come his way from the Class of 2028 prospect the Warriors are excited about.</p>

<p class="text-gray-700">Muncie Central's Isaiah Amerson has picked up offers from UTSA, San Diego State, and Toledo this month. What strikes me about Amerson is that he is a great all-around edge: displays a solid motor to rush the passer and pursue running backs, but has the athleticism to leap over the line of scrimmage and bat down passes. Class of 2027 prospect who is a very disruptive player with a chance to develop with the right coach in a college program.</p>
